Driveshaft Shimming Using Tool PIN 315767 The driveshaft pinion is precisely meshed with the forward and reverse gears by the use of shim or shims between the driveshaft bearing housing and thrust washerWhen installing new thrust bearing or washer, bearing housing, pinion, or driveshaft, it is necessary to gauge and select the proper shims to restore factory clearance INote Degrease pinion and driveshaft tapers prior to assembly1Clean the driveshaft and pinion in clean solvent and dry thoroughlyAssemble the pinion to the driveshaft and tighten the pinion nut to torque of 40-45 ftIbs(54-60 Nm)2Place OMC Shim Gauge, PI 315767, in vise as shown

mm) of drives haft shimsClean the shims in solvent and dry thoroughlyCarefully measure shims using micrometerPosition the shims between the driveshaft and shim gauge as shownMeasure the clearance between the top of the shim gauge and the pinion using feeler gauge while pressing down on the driveshaft
5To obtain correct shim measurement, subtract the measurement obtained with the feeler gauge from the total measurement of shims between the drives haft and shim gaugeUse the amount of shims to give zero clearance
